This rug http://www.kirklands.com/product/Tex...299/157002.uts was the inspiration for my card today. I love the inset/inlaid embossing technique with shapes such as this and I really liked the colors in the rug as well. I made the circles by punching the smaller circle first then using the larger circle punch lined up in an offset fashion to punch the offset shape and repeated the process with each smaller circle. I finished the card off with a Chocolate Chip bow and a sentiment with rounded edges.
